Output 88951c5c6493cbd7245a77ac003ae6dd60c9f286c23f2331c695485795ebbb87:1
- value
- 66385712
- script pubkey
- OP_0 OP_PUSHBYTES_20 508ff400443bea7dc5da511bba935fdfd94b4ef6
- address
- bc1q2z8lgqzy8048m3w62ydm4y6lmlv5knhkdnmyew
- transaction
- 88951c5c6493cbd7245a77ac003ae6dd60c9f286c23f2331c695485795ebbb87